#!/usr/bin/env python3
"""
Process Lattes JSON files into standardized faculty data.
Expects files in data/json/ directory.
Outputs unified JSON to data/processed/faculty_data.json
"""
import json
import os
from pathlib import Path
from typing import Dict, List, Any, Union
import re
def safe_string(value: Any) -> str:
"""Safely convert any value to a clean string."""
if value is None:
return ""
if isinstance(value, str):
return clean_text(value)
if isinstance(value, list):
# If it's a list of strings, join them
if all(isinstance(item, str) for item in value):
return clean_text(" ".join(value))
# If it's a list of dicts, try to extract meaningful text
elif all(isinstance(item, dict) for item in value):
# For now, return empty string or first item's description if it's a dict with desc
# This is a fallback - we'll handle specific cases in the processing
return ""
else:
# Mixed or other types - convert each to string and join
return clean_text(" ".join(str(item) for item in value))
# For dict, int, float, etc.
return clean_text(str(value))
def clean_text(text: str) -> str:
"""Clean and normalize text."""
if not text:
return ""
# Remove extra whitespace and normalize
text = re.sub(r'\s+', ' ', text.strip())
return text
def extract_name_from_lattes(nome_completo: str) -> str:
"""Extract clean name from Lattes format."""
if not nome_completo:
return ""
# Lattes sometimes has names in format "SOBRENOME, Nome"
if ',' in nome_completo:
parts = nome_completo.split(',', 1)
if len(parts) == 2:
sobrenome = parts[0].strip()
nome = parts[1].strip()
# If nome seems to be first name(s) and sobrenome is last name
if len(nome.split()) <= 3 and len(sobrenome.split()) <= 3:
return f"{nome} {sobrenome}"
return nome_completo
